Hi all, I’m constantly having to re-adjust the park brake shoes on my LJ78 (rear disc with drum park brake) I bought news shoes and adjusters but it didn’t last long before they needed re adjusting again…

im thinking of replacing the rear calipers with ones with a built in park brake, has anyone got any recommendations that won’t require me to make all new brackets?

of course the other option is a transmission park brake but IMO they are not as good.

I think the park brake set up is more or less the same as most other Landcruisers, any info would be great 👍🏻
 
Sounds normal unfortunately...

I now have an 80 series rear axle, it has a similar but larger brake setup, & the same reputation for crapness. Terrain tamer actually make a 1.5mm longer strut to improve the park brake:

i-2PhqZ4w-M.jpg


This may even be the same part as the LJ, or you could try modifying your ones with a blob of weld & some grinding & filing. The other thing that improved mine was replacing the drums after I discovered that they were out of round. Then careful adjustment following through the procedure in the manual.
